Ultrasensitive, High-Throughput nanoHDX-MS for Insights into Protein Dynamics and Interactions

Join our webinar to discover the future of structural proteomics with our novel nano-flow HDX-MS (nHDX-MS) platform. Presented by Dr. Malvina Papanastasiou, this webinar will introduce groundbreaking technology that offers unprecedented sensitivity and throughput. By integrating nanoflow liquid chromatography with a fully automated sample preparation and data analysis workflow, our innovative approach achieves a remarkable >50-fold increase in sensitivity and higher-throughput over traditional methods. This leap enables the analysis of precious, and large complexes with minimal sample material, delivering same-day results.
